The surname Isomäki is of Finnish origin and is relatively common in Finland compared to other countries. In this article, we will delve into the history and significance of the Isomäki surname, exploring its distribution in different countries and its potential origins.
The surname Isomäki has its roots in Finland, where it is a fairly common surname. The name is derived from the Finnish words "iso," meaning big or large, and "mäki," meaning hill. Therefore, Isomäki can be interpreted as "big hill" or "large hill." This suggests that the original bearers of the surname may have lived near or on a large hill.
In Finland, the Isomäki surname has a significant presence, with 939 incidences reported. While Isomäki is primarily found in Finland, it has also spread to other countries, albeit in smaller numbers. In Sweden, there are 54 incidences of the surname, suggesting a limited but notable presence in the country. Estonia, Norway, Germany, Denmark, and New Zealand each have a small number of individuals with the Isomäki surname, indicating a minor international spread.
